Thames Water in the UK Poised for $13.5 Billion Rescue Package from Silver Point and Elliott, Reports Bloomberg News

UK's Thames Water set for over $13.5 billion rescue deal by Silver Point and Elliott, Bloomberg News reports

Thames Water’s $13.5 Billion Rescue: Why This Matters and What’s Next In a significant move that could reshape the financial landscape of Britain’s water utility sector, U.S. investment firms Silver Point Capital and Elliott Management … Read more

China Could Take a ‘Retaliatory’ Step That Experts Warn Will Significantly Impact U.S. Homeowners. Here’s What You Need to Know.

China may make a ‘retaliatory’ move that experts say will ‘hit' US homeowners 'hard.' Here's what's happening

Jeffrey Greenberg/Universal Images Group/Getty Images Extreme Investor Network may earn commission or revenue through links in the content below. Recent fluctuations in the U.S. Treasury bond market have caught the attention of investors and analysts … Read more